Post by: Homer on March 10, 2006, 06:52:04 PM
While your at it first clear your cache by going to

Tools
Internet Options
General Tab
Delete Files
Click OK to the popup and it will begin removing the files.

When that is done click the button next to it that says Settings

Click on View Objects
A window will open that shows your pogo game files.
Find the one for Spades and right click the file and left click on the Remove option.
This will remove your current Spades game files.
Close this window and click ok to close any open popups.

For good measure reboot your pc then go back to pogo and try again.

When you go back to Spades you should get a popup to reinstall the game files. You want to do that so click ok or whatever the command is that pops up.
